Show Poultry Officials Boosting Industry "Utah's milk white eggs" are now 'famed throughout the United States and New York, Detroit, points in Florida, California and other states are receiving the splendid quality eggs being produced in Utah and each year sees a bigger growth and market for the Utah product. This was the expression of Benj. Brown, ! director of sales shipments for the Utah Poultry Producers association on his visit here last Friday. Mr. Brown was accompanied by Bert Willardson, vice-president of the or- ganization, and the officials were j here conferring with local poultry-: men on feed, baby chick shipments and with a view to instilling a greater great-er interest in the poultry business. Last year, according to Mr. Brown, the Utah association shipped 2,000,-000, 2,000,-000, the shipments going to large eastern centers where the famous "milk white eggs" hare gained an enviable place for the large .hotels and in the homes. Proper feeding and care and proper culling and the grading of the eggs has been responsible, respon-sible, to a degree, for the large popularity pop-ularity of the Utah product on the eastern markets. Feeding, Mr. Brown stated, is one of the important factors fac-tors in the success of the poultry-men. poultry-men. Where this has been followed on a scientific basis, the poultryman never fails,' providing, however, oth-j oth-j er essential points are properly car-ed car-ed for. The Utah Poultry Producers association asso-ciation bad its inception in Gunni-" Gunni-" son some few years ago. At the time j the association was established three men comprised the working forces. Today the association boasts of eight assembling plants in the state, with 150 on the payroll. The American Refrigeration company, realizing the magnitude of the Utah concern, is preparing more cars for the transportation trans-portation of the egg product of this state and has notified the head officers offi-cers that as many cars as will be necessary will be available at a moment's mo-ment's notice.
